Arbuthnot funds Beltline’s acquisition of expert packaging

Arbuthnot Commercial ABL has arranged a £2.25 million funding package to support Beltline’s acquisition of Expert Packaging, which aligns with the group’s ongoing expansion strategy in the corrugated cardboard industry. The funding consists of a customised package, including a confidential invoice discounting line and a term loan, aimed at facilitating the acquisition. This package also offers additional working capital post-acquisition, alongside fresh equity contributions from a high-net-worth investor.

This recent acquisition follows Beltline’s earlier purchases of First Packaging Services and Leighton Packaging in late 2023. Beltline sees the acquisition of Expert Packaging as a significant milestone that enhances its revenue and profit potential, with an ambitious management team set to contribute to the group’s next phase of growth.

The Beltline group operates from three locations across the North West of England, including Expert Packaging’s recently renovated 15,000 square-foot warehouse in Bury. The group provides a range of services that span from manufacturing to the wholesale of corrugated cardboard packaging, as well as related ancillaries and consumables.
